How they compare

Rwanda currently reports 485,411 LCU against 359,399 LCU in Malawi, a difference of 126,012 LCU.

That makes Rwanda's figure about 1.4 times Malawi's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 9 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Rwanda ahead.

Malawi ranks 22nd and Rwanda ranks 19th of 123 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Malawi averaged higher in 1 and Rwanda in 1.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
